- Author contribution statement
- Tanvir was a member of the writing team, and led VINROUGE, one of the six major collaborations that independently discovered the electromagnetic counterpart to the binary neutron star merger reported in the paper. He contributed to text (specifically writing parts of section 2.3, and contributing to the editing more widely), figure 2 and photometric analysis (particularly VISTA, VLT and HST data).
